Update `AutoConfigurationSorter` so that `getClassesRequestedAfter()`
results are sorted to match the earlier name/order sorting. Prior to
this commit the order of items added via `@AutoConfigureAfter` was in
an undetermined order which could cause very subtle `@ConditionalOnBean`
bugs.

The stream auto-configuration is tested in RabbitStreamConfigurationTests,
and excluding it prevents the creation of the "rabbitStreamEnvironment"
Environment bean, which delays the application context close by 1 second
because it has to wait for some Netty resources to gracefully shut down.

When the filter is exposed as a bean (directly or through a
registration bean), it's picked up by the auto-configuration of
MockMvc. This causes a problem as MockMvc does not call init on a
filter before it's used and WebSocketUpgradeFilter fails with a
NullPointerException if its doFilter method is called when its init
method has not been called.
This commit reworks the WebSocket auto-configuration to use a
ServletContextInitalizer to register WebSocketUpgradeFilter rather
than a FilterRegistrationBean. This ensure that the filter is still
registered at the required position in the chain (last filter before
the servlet) while also preventing it from being registered with the
auto-configured MockMvc in tests.

Update JMS listener concurrency configuration to set the same minimum
and maximum number of consumers when users specify only the minimum
using `spring.jms.listener.concurrency` property.
Prior to this commit, when using `spring.jms.listener.concurrency` to
set the minimum number of consumers without also specifying
`spring.jms.listener.max-concurrency` would result in effective
concurrency where the actual minimum number of consumers is always 1,
while the maximum number of consumers is the value of
`spring.jms.listener.concurrency`.
